Bhandari fires Nepal into Vianet International Women's Championship final

  • 2025-02-20

Sabitra Bhandari's decisive strike secured Nepal a 1-0 victory over Lebanon, sending them into the final of the Vianet International Women's Championship 2025 on Thursday.

Nepal dominated proceedings at Dasharath Stadium but struggled to break down Lebanon’s resilient defense. Bimala Chaudhary had an early opportunity to put Nepal ahead but sent her shot over the bar in the 10th minute.

The breakthrough finally came in the 42nd minute when Lebanon cleared a corner delivered by Chaudhary, only for Bhandari to unleash a powerful shot. The effort deflected off defender Farah El Tayar and found the back of the net.

Sabita Rana Magar had a golden chance to extend Nepal’s lead in the second half but failed to convert Bhandari’s precise cross, sending her shot wide of the post.

In the day’s earlier match, Myanmar cruised to a 5-0 victory over Kyrgyzstan.

Nepal will now compete Myanmar in the final on Wednesday The two sides will also meet in the final group game on Sunday.
